SEC charges BlockFi with a $100 million fine for failure to comply with regulatory law

The SEC has charged crypto lending business BlockFi with a $100M penalty for failing to register high-yield interest accounts that the agency considers securities. The penalty also requires the business to stop onboarding new customers to its unregistered service, BlockFi Interest Accounts. Valkyrie applies to the SEC to list its Bitcoin Miners ETF on Nasdaq

According to Valkyrie, the Bitcoin Miners ETF will have a 0.75% management fee and will invest in both domestic and international companies. Valkyrie, a crypto asset management, has applied to the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) in the United States to establish an exchange-traded fund (ETF) that invests in bitcoin mining firms on Nasdaq.
